英文摘要
With their novel and unique properties, nanomaterials offer new routes to address pressing needs in strategically important energy, environmental and health sectors. Furthermore, the combination of nanomaterials with different properties into nanocomposites is even more attractive since they can lead to largely improved properties and/or multiple functionalities unachievable with a single material. The chairholder will devote her effort i) to the forefront research in advanced nanocomposite materials by using cost-effective wet-chemistry to synthesize highly functional nanomaterials and further combining them towards important environmental, energy and biomedical applications, and ii) to the training of highly qualified personnel in these areas.
